Here is the issue. The rifle fed as a 30-06 perfectly. When rebarreled to the 280 AI it required work to make it feed properly, but never did feed like the 30-06. I never said it didn't feed. I said it required additional work. There is a difference. And proper feeding, I've found, has very subjective definitions.

I should point out that I hunt coyotes and such with a 243 AI. It feeds fine, but required more work than the standard 243 to do so. I'm sorry if this offends you, but it is what it is.
